Nira sat on her bed, staring blankly at the forest green walls before her. The white sheets lay behind her in a messy heap, the remains of the nightmare she had had the night before.
"I don't know how much more of this I can take." She told the wall sadly. "They won't even tell me why they're keeping me here."
Unfortunately, the wall said nothing back. But she was sure if could talk; it would have nothing to say to that anyway.
"No, I can't think of why either. And now, it's only getting worse. Ever since the accident no one will talk to me. And you might find this hard to believe, but I think I'm losing my mind."
The wall stared disbelieving at her. If walls could stare that is.
"Yeah, you're right. I haven't gone that far off the deep end."
"Ok, do I really want to know why you're talking to that wall?" a voice said next to her.
Startled, Nira jumped a foot in the air and slid off the bed. She landed with an oomph on the floor.
". 31 seconds." Axel said staring down at her. "That's gotta be a new record."
"Holy crab noodles how'd you get in here so fast?" she asked skeptically.
"What's a crab noodle?"
"No idea. Don't change the subject."
"Well maybe if you weren't so busy talking to your wall over there you would have heard me come in."
"Well maybe if you would just knock I would have heard you. And it's not like I was expecting company anytime soon anyway." She glared up at him.
"I'm sorry." He said looking down. "How are you feeling?"
"I've been better." She said coldly crossing her arms irritated and tossing her head to the side.
"Look I wanted to come, but I didn't want Zexy trying anything."
"What do you mean?"
"I mean like him pretending to be you to stab me in the back when I least-well anyway, I tried to come see you as soon as I could."
"And it took you 3 days?" she asked raising an eyebrow.
"Hey I tried ok?" he said defensively putting his hands in the air in an 'I surrender' pose. "It's not like it used to be when Roxas was-" he stopped abruptly and Nira watched the read head's face fall.
"What?" she urged him to continue.
"Never mind." He said, putting an unreadable expression on.
"No, tell me."
"It's just not the same since Roxas left. We could pull all kinds of things around here, and get away with it all. You think Demyx is bad, you should have seen Roxas and me when we kicked this boring place up. We were a great team." Axel leaned back on his hands and looked up at the ceiling. She watched as his memories played by in his mind. She could almost see them herself reflecting in his green eyes.
"What happened to him?"
Axel's gaze hardened, but he didn't stop looking at the ceiling. "He left. And betrayed organization 13 while he was at it."
She frowned sympathetically. "Why did he leave?"
"To find his other."
"What's an other?"
Axel gazed down at her and opened his mouth, just about to say something, when a loud knock was heard on the other side of number 13's door. Axel lunged for the ground, landing as softly as he could, and rolled under the bed. The whole move looked so funny Nira had to hold her breath to stifle a giggle.
"What are you doing?" She asked him quietly.
"They don't know I came to see you." He whispered back. "Quick, open the door and pretend like I'm not here."
She gave a brief nod and opened the door to reveal Zexion standing there with a tray of food. Nira heard Axel mutter a curse word from under the bed. If he didn't want to be found, why was he being so obvious?
Zexion walked past her and placed the tray on the bedside table.
"Come out." He said to the walls. No one answered.
Nira bit her lip. 'If Zexion finds him, another fight is gonna break out.' She thought panicking. The last thing she needed was another fight between those two.
Zexion walked over to one of her newly painted walls and hit it with a fist. "Come out you damn coward!" he shouted.
"Zexion stop!" Nira tried to calm him. Maybe she could get him to leave. Say Axel left a while ago.
"Axel left a few minutes ago. He's not here anymore." Her lie must have sounded terrible because Zexion looked at her with a disbelieving glare and walked over to the bed.
"I can smell you. There's no point in hiding."
Nira bit her lip until she felt cold, steely blood trickle down. He sauntered closer and closer to the bed until he was just a few inches in front of it. If Axel was under there, he would be able to see the shorter nobody's shoes right in front of his face.
"I can smell a coward a hundred miles away." He growled again to the room. "Come out…now-!" Zexion lifted up the quilt that Axel had placed over the crack between the matrices and the floor so that no one could see under it. Nira let out a barley audible gasp-but no one was there. Axel had gotten away.
Zexion growled in frustration, letting the quilt fall back into place. Before leaving he turned to her and simply said, "If you ever see him again, you are to tell me. And if you don't, I will know."
Then he left, slamming the door closed behind him and making her teeth chatter.
